Invertebrates make up more than 80 percent of all known species and provide humans with a myriad of valuable services—from crop pollination to their use as food—yet they are overlooked and underrepresented in conservation decisions and on priority lists of threatened and endangered species. A new study shows that as climate change enhances tree growth in tropical forests, the resulting increase in litterfall could stimulate soil micro-organisms leading to a release of stored soil carbon. [...more]

Alaska’s pristine coastline is ripe for an influx of invasive marine species such as the European green crab and the rough periwinkle (an Atlantic sea snail) warns a new study by a team of scientists from the Smithsonian Environmental Research Center. [...more]

Nutmeg-loving toucans wearing GPS transmitters recently helped a team of scientists at the Smithsonian Tropical Research Institute in Panama address an age-old problem in plant ecology: accurately estimating seed dispersal. [...more]
